== English == === Noun === olas plural of ola == Finnish == === Etymology === Borrowed from Sami (compare Northern Sami oalis). === Pronunciation === IPA(key): /ˈolɑs/, [ˈo̞lɑ̝s̠] Rhymes: -olɑs Syllabification(key): o‧las Hyphenation(key): olas === Noun === olas The long groove on the bottom of a ski. ==== Declension ==== === Further reading === “olas”, in Kielitoimiston sanakirja [Dictionary of Contemporary Finnish]‎[1] (in Finnish) (online dictionary, continuously updated), Kotimaisten kielten keskuksen verkkojulkaisuja 35, Helsinki: Kotimaisten kielten tutkimuskeskus (Institute for the Languages of Finland), 2004–, retrieved 3 July 2023 === Anagrams === Laos, Salo, salo, sola == Kankanaey == === Alternative forms === ulas === Etymology === Borrowed either directly from Spanish horas or through Ilocano oras. === Pronunciation === IPA(key): /ˈʔolas/ [ˈʔoː.lʌs] Rhymes: -olas (parts of Bauko, Sabangan and Tadian) IPA(key): /ˈʔolah/ [ˈʔoː.lʌh] Rhymes: -olah (Sagada, parts of Sabangan) IPA(key): /ˈʔoras/ [ˈʔoː.rʌs] Rhymes: -oras Syllabification: o‧las === Noun === ólas hour time ==== Derived terms ==== == Latin == === Pronunciation === (Classical Latin) IPA(key): [ˈoː.ɫaːs] (modern Italianate Ecclesiastical) IPA(key): [ˈɔː.las] === Noun === ōlās f accusative plural of ōla == Latvian == === Noun === olas m inflection of ola: genitive singular nominative/vocative/accusative plural == Portuguese == === Noun === olas plural of ola == Spanish == === Noun === olas f pl plural of ola == Volapük == === Pronoun === olas (possessive) (genitive plural of ol) your (plural) ==== Synonyms ==== olsik
